原创 Spring boot 報錯:Cannot determine embedded database driver class for database type NONE

最近在搞Spring boot的框架項目,配置文件什麼的都配置好了,就是無緣無故的拋出錯誤,如下: 嘗試了網上說的各種辦法,修改配置文件,但就是沒用,結果還是在一個外網上看到: 頓時喜笑顏開,結果在pom.xml文件中加入依賴的jar

原创 Emoji表情在web端的展示步驟詳解!!!

1、先上張圖片,給大家看看需求是什麼樣的: 要求在安卓端或是iOS端上添加的emoji表情要能在web端進行展示出來。 2、拿到這種需求,對於底層的程序員來說,沒辦法以前沒接觸過,我只在鬥圖中見它們的次數比較多,所以只能去尋找度孃的幫

原创 字符串轉json數組的解決辦法

前提:當需要把一串字符串轉成一個json 數組 ,並遍歷其中的內容時。 第一步:首先導入 net.sf.json.JSONArray和net.sf.json.JSONObject 兩個jar 包 Java: String

原创 Java Struts2 POI創建Excel文件並實現文件下載

在做管理系統的時候,經常會用到文件的下載,特別是Excel報表的創建與下載,下面就來簡單演示一下,Struts2實現的Excel文件的下載功能。 由於本實驗是要動態創建Excel文件,因此需要一些jar: Java讀寫Excel的包

原创 使用ArrayList時的注意事項:去除多餘的null值

問題描述:在課表導入的時候,將數據從excel表裏讀出,然後將list批量插入到對應的課程表的數據表單中去,出現結果:當我們導入3條數據時,list.size()爲3,但是實際上,list裏面存在10條數據,只不過前三條數據有值,後面所

原创 Java工程師面試必看

  打算換個工作,近一個月面試了不少的公司,下面將一些面試經驗和思考分享給大家。另外校招也快要開始了,爲在校的學生提供一些經驗供參考,希望都能找到滿意的工作。         剛開始面試的幾家公司,就是備受各種打擊、就是一頓狂問,結果答上

原创 Mybatis中接口和對應的mapper文件位置配置深入剖析

首先要說明的問題是,Mybatis中接口和對應的mapper文件不一定要放在同一個包下,放在一起的目的是爲了Mybatis進行自動掃描,並且要注意此時java接口的名稱和mapper文件的名稱要相同,否則會報異常,由於此時Mybatis

原创 問題描述:Tomcat部署項目,出現了“GC overhead limit exceeded” 問題

想法:做的是Excel導出的場景,數據量大概在30/40萬條左右,所以考慮到請求到數據可能會花費的時間比較長導致了上面的問題出現,後面去修改了Tomcat的連接時間 以爲這樣就不會報錯,結果殘酷的現實啪啪打臉啊、還是崩了,後面沒辦法了,只

原创 JavaPOI在解決導出大數據量的處理方案(導出數據在一百萬行左右)

Excel2003版最大行數是65536行。Excel2007開始的版本最大行數是1048576行。Excel2003的最大列數是256列,2007以上版本是16384列。 poi導出excel,不使用模板的http://happyqin

原创 Tomcat下發布war包產生兩個不同版本的訪問地址的解決方案appBase和docBase的關係

現象:之前遇到很奇怪的問題,發完版之後沒有效果,頁面還是讀取上一版的。反覆查找原因發現  http://localhost:8080/mobie 這個路徑下的頁面是正常的,而  http://localhost:8080/這個頁面是舊版本

原创 FastJson對於JSON格式字符串、JSON對象及JavaBean之間的相互轉換

fastJson對於json格式字符串的解析主要用到了一下三個類:JSON:fastJson的解析器,用於JSON格式字符串與JSON對象及javaBean之間的轉換。JSONObject:fastJson提供的json對象。JSONAr

原创 SpringBoot+Thyemleaf開發環境正常,打包jar發到服務器就報錯Template might not exist or might not be accessible

網上查看了各種解決的思路,總結如下:1. 在controller層請求處理完了返回時,沒有使用@RestController或@ResponseBody而返回了非json格式這種情況下返回的數據thymeleaf模板無法解析,直接報錯,本

原创 解決使用intellij idea開發MAVEN項目在target目錄下不存在mapper.xml文件

“Invalid bound statement (not found):com.beauxie.wxj.dao.UserMapper.findUserByCondition ”,說明這個異常是在調用Mapper接口時發生的,看到這個異常

原创 mongoTemplate查詢大數據過慢

先上兩段代碼 代碼一Query query = new Query(); queryAfter.addCriteria(Criteria.where("id").in(idList)); queryAfter.addCriteria(Cr

原创 很詳細的設置Tomcat爲後臺服務啓動

查看鏈接:https://jingyan.baidu.com/article/a65957f4b12b8724e77f9b5a.html很詳細